INDO GULF PEST CONTROLS | E-Showroom
INDO GULF PEST CONTROLS NIL/26, 2ND FLOOR, MALVIYA NAGAR, New Delhi
Phone 91-11-26674650/26674651/26674652/26425349
HOTELS
Hotel Goradias
Hotels Room